radv: don't fast-clear eliminate after resolving a subpass with compute
That looks useless, and I think radv_handle_image_transition() will do a fast-clear eliminate because it's called after the resolve. Signed-off-by: Samuel Pitoiset <samuel.pitoiset@gmail.com> Reviewed-by: Bas Niuwenhuizen <bas@basnieuwenhuizen.nl>
